Inclusion criteria
Inclusion criteria: 1. Age: 18 to 65 years old, ASA (American Society of Anesthesiologists) grade I to III; 2. Patients who are scheduled to undergo total shoulder arthroplasty or rotator cuff repair surgery; 3. Preoperative cognitive function is normal, and the patient can correctly understand pain rating scales (such as NRS scores); 4. There was no history of chronic pain or long-term use of opioids before the operation
Exclusion criteria
Exclusion criteria: 1.History of allergy to local anesthetics (e.g., bupivacaine, ropivacaine) or liposome components; 2.Severe hepatic or renal insufficiency, coagulation dysfunction; 3.Drug abuse or alcoholism; 4.Preexisting neurological or psychiatric diseases affecting pain perception; 5.Patients requiring additional anesthetic analgesic interventions during surgery;
